lotteryThe World Lottery Association (WLA) is an international, member-based organization of state-authorized lotteries, stateOn Fastest Lottery Provider in Sri Lanka. National Lotteries Board (NLB) and Development Lotteries Board (DLB) - Lottery in Sri Lanka